Film review | Storage 24 – British sci-fi thriller is a shocker (and that’s just the acting)
The driving force behind hoodie melodramas Kidulthood and Adulthood, girl-power caper flick 4.3.2.1. and sports drama Fast Girls, Noel Clarke now turns his hand to the sci-fi thriller genre as co-writer, producer and star of Storage 24. A military cargo … Continue reading
